GRE: GRADUATE RECORD EXAMINATION :

GRE or Graduate Record Examination is a world renowned admission test required to be given by the candidates desirous of taking admission to graduate programs primarily in the area of engineering and sciences at education institutions in USA. The GRE is designed to help graduate schools assess the qualifications of applicants for advanced study in technical fields as well as Business schools. SCORING :
    • Essays are scored on a scale of 0 – 6 in 0.5 increments.
    • Quantitative Reasoning section is scored on a scale of 130 – 170 in 1 point increment.
    • Verbal Reasoning section is scored on a scale of 130 – 170 in 1 point increment.
